Output 54d835087c81bcc37b3ac08d3bca806ee6e09b789075d7a5625c267ba1d74d60:0

value
21183
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4af5c0a60cb1b4261592f76eda7a57e99d90c95dbefae289b059a3010e29ed0c
address
bc1pft6upfsvkx6zv9vj7ahd57jhaxwepj2ahmaw9zdstx3szr3fa5xqcx77lu
transaction
54d835087c81bcc37b3ac08d3bca806ee6e09b789075d7a5625c267ba1d74d60
spent
true